not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)

/commits.php is going away

I'm proposing to take /commits.php away - it mainly duplicates the home page. Details in this GitHub issue.
Port details
chicken5 Scheme-to-C compiler
5.2.0 lang on this many watch lists=0 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out 5.2.0Version of this port present on the latest quarterly branch.
Maintainer: gahr@FreeBSD.org search for ports maintained by this maintainer
Port Added: 2018-08-22 17:46:41
Last Update: 2021-08-23 08:17:12
Commit Hash: 80236c9
Also Listed In: scheme
License: BSD3CLAUSE PD
Description:
SVNWeb : git : Homepage
pkg-plist: as obtained via: make generate-plist
Expand this list (156 items)
Collapse this list.
  1. @ldconfig
  2. /usr/local/share/licenses/chicken5-5.2.0/catalog.mk
  3. /usr/local/share/licenses/chicken5-5.2.0/LICENSE
  4. /usr/local/share/licenses/chicken5-5.2.0/BSD3CLAUSE
  5. /usr/local/share/licenses/chicken5-5.2.0/PD
  6. bin/chicken5
  7. bin/chicken-do5
  8. bin/chicken-install5
  9. bin/chicken-profile5
  10. bin/chicken-status5
  11. bin/chicken-uninstall5
  12. bin/csc5
  13. bin/csi5
  14. @comment bin/feathers5
  15. include/chicken5/chicken-config.h
  16. include/chicken5/chicken.h
  17. lib/chicken5/11/chicken.base.import.so
  18. lib/chicken5/11/chicken.bitwise.import.so
  19. lib/chicken5/11/chicken.blob.import.so
  20. lib/chicken5/11/chicken.compiler.user-pass.import.so
  21. lib/chicken5/11/chicken.condition.import.so
  22. lib/chicken5/11/chicken.continuation.import.so
  23. lib/chicken5/11/chicken.csi.import.so
  24. lib/chicken5/11/chicken.errno.import.so
  25. lib/chicken5/11/chicken.eval.import.so
  26. lib/chicken5/11/chicken.file.import.so
  27. lib/chicken5/11/chicken.file.posix.import.so
  28. lib/chicken5/11/chicken.fixnum.import.so
  29. lib/chicken5/11/chicken.flonum.import.so
  30. lib/chicken5/11/chicken.foreign.import.so
  31. lib/chicken5/11/chicken.format.import.so
  32. lib/chicken5/11/chicken.gc.import.so
  33. lib/chicken5/11/chicken.internal.import.so
  34. lib/chicken5/11/chicken.io.import.so
  35. lib/chicken5/11/chicken.irregex.import.so
  36. lib/chicken5/11/chicken.keyword.import.so
  37. lib/chicken5/11/chicken.load.import.so
  38. lib/chicken5/11/chicken.locative.import.so
  39. lib/chicken5/11/chicken.memory.import.so
  40. lib/chicken5/11/chicken.memory.representation.import.so
  41. lib/chicken5/11/chicken.pathname.import.so
  42. lib/chicken5/11/chicken.platform.import.so
  43. lib/chicken5/11/chicken.plist.import.so
  44. lib/chicken5/11/chicken.port.import.so
  45. lib/chicken5/11/chicken.pretty-print.import.so
  46. lib/chicken5/11/chicken.process-context.import.so
  47. lib/chicken5/11/chicken.process-context.posix.import.so
  48. lib/chicken5/11/chicken.process.import.so
  49. lib/chicken5/11/chicken.process.signal.import.so
  50. lib/chicken5/11/chicken.random.import.so
  51. lib/chicken5/11/chicken.read-syntax.import.so
  52. lib/chicken5/11/chicken.repl.import.so
  53. lib/chicken5/11/chicken.sort.import.so
  54. lib/chicken5/11/chicken.string.import.so
  55. lib/chicken5/11/chicken.syntax.import.so
  56. lib/chicken5/11/chicken.tcp.import.so
  57. lib/chicken5/11/chicken.time.import.so
  58. lib/chicken5/11/chicken.time.posix.import.so
  59. lib/chicken5/11/srfi-4.import.so
  60. lib/chicken5/11/types.db
  61. lib/libchicken5.a
  62. lib/libchicken5.so
  63. lib/libchicken5.so.11
  64. man/man1/chicken-do5.1.gz
  65. man/man1/chicken-install5.1.gz
  66. man/man1/chicken-profile5.1.gz
  67. man/man1/chicken-status5.1.gz
  68. man/man1/chicken-uninstall5.1.gz
  69. man/man1/chicken5.1.gz
  70. man/man1/csc5.1.gz
  71. man/man1/csi5.1.gz
  72. @comment man/man1/feathers5.1.gz
  73. @comment share/chicken5/feathers.tcl
  74. share/chicken5/setup.defaults
  75. share/doc/chicken5/DEPRECATED
  76. @comment share/doc/chicken5/LICENSE
  77. share/doc/chicken5/NEWS
  78. share/doc/chicken5/README
  79. share/doc/chicken5/manual/Accessing external objects.html
  80. share/doc/chicken5/manual/Acknowledgements.html
  81. share/doc/chicken5/manual/Bibliography.html
  82. share/doc/chicken5/manual/Bugs and limitations.html
  83. share/doc/chicken5/manual/C interface.html
  84. share/doc/chicken5/manual/Cross development.html
  85. share/doc/chicken5/manual/Data representation.html
  86. share/doc/chicken5/manual/Debugging.html
  87. share/doc/chicken5/manual/Declarations.html
  88. share/doc/chicken5/manual/Deployment.html
  89. share/doc/chicken5/manual/Deviations from the standard.html
  90. share/doc/chicken5/manual/Egg specification format.html
  91. share/doc/chicken5/manual/Embedding.html
  92. share/doc/chicken5/manual/Extension tools.html
  93. share/doc/chicken5/manual/Extensions to the standard.html
  94. share/doc/chicken5/manual/Extensions.html
  95. share/doc/chicken5/manual/Foreign type specifiers.html
  96. share/doc/chicken5/manual/Getting started.html
  97. share/doc/chicken5/manual/Included modules.html
  98. share/doc/chicken5/manual/Interface to external functions and variables.html
  99. share/doc/chicken5/manual/Module (chicken base).html
  100. share/doc/chicken5/manual/Module (chicken bitwise).html
  101. share/doc/chicken5/manual/Module (chicken blob).html
  102. share/doc/chicken5/manual/Module (chicken condition).html
  103. share/doc/chicken5/manual/Module (chicken continuation).html
  104. share/doc/chicken5/manual/Module (chicken csi).html
  105. share/doc/chicken5/manual/Module (chicken errno).html
  106. share/doc/chicken5/manual/Module (chicken eval).html
  107. share/doc/chicken5/manual/Module (chicken file posix).html
  108. share/doc/chicken5/manual/Module (chicken file).html
  109. share/doc/chicken5/manual/Module (chicken fixnum).html
  110. share/doc/chicken5/manual/Module (chicken flonum).html
  111. share/doc/chicken5/manual/Module (chicken foreign).html
  112. share/doc/chicken5/manual/Module (chicken format).html
  113. share/doc/chicken5/manual/Module (chicken gc).html
  114. share/doc/chicken5/manual/Module (chicken io).html
  115. share/doc/chicken5/manual/Module (chicken irregex).html
  116. share/doc/chicken5/manual/Module (chicken keyword).html
  117. share/doc/chicken5/manual/Module (chicken load).html
  118. share/doc/chicken5/manual/Module (chicken locative).html
  119. share/doc/chicken5/manual/Module (chicken memory representation).html
  120. share/doc/chicken5/manual/Module (chicken memory).html
  121. share/doc/chicken5/manual/Module (chicken module).html
  122. share/doc/chicken5/manual/Module (chicken pathname).html
  123. share/doc/chicken5/manual/Module (chicken platform).html
  124. share/doc/chicken5/manual/Module (chicken plist).html
  125. share/doc/chicken5/manual/Module (chicken port).html
  126. share/doc/chicken5/manual/Module (chicken pretty-print).html
  127. share/doc/chicken5/manual/Module (chicken process signal).html
  128. share/doc/chicken5/manual/Module (chicken process).html
  129. share/doc/chicken5/manual/Module (chicken process-context posix).html
  130. share/doc/chicken5/manual/Module (chicken process-context).html
  131. share/doc/chicken5/manual/Module (chicken random).html
  132. share/doc/chicken5/manual/Module (chicken read-syntax).html
  133. share/doc/chicken5/manual/Module (chicken repl).html
  134. share/doc/chicken5/manual/Module (chicken sort).html
  135. share/doc/chicken5/manual/Module (chicken string).html
  136. share/doc/chicken5/manual/Module (chicken syntax).html
  137. share/doc/chicken5/manual/Module (chicken tcp).html
  138. share/doc/chicken5/manual/Module (chicken time posix).html
  139. share/doc/chicken5/manual/Module (chicken time).html
  140. share/doc/chicken5/manual/Module (chicken type).html
  141. share/doc/chicken5/manual/Module r4rs.html
  142. share/doc/chicken5/manual/Module r5rs.html
  143. share/doc/chicken5/manual/Module scheme.html
  144. share/doc/chicken5/manual/Module srfi-4.html
  145. share/doc/chicken5/manual/Modules.html
  146. share/doc/chicken5/manual/The User's Manual.html
  147. share/doc/chicken5/manual/Types.html
  148. share/doc/chicken5/manual/Units and linking model.html
  149. share/doc/chicken5/manual/Using the compiler.html
  150. share/doc/chicken5/manual/Using the interpreter.html
  151. share/doc/chicken5/manual/manual.css
  152. @postexec %D/bin/chicken-install5 -update-db
  153. @postunexec rm -f %D/lib/chicken5/11/modules.db
  154. @owner
  155. @group
  156. @mode
Collapse this list.
Dependency lines:
  • For RUN/BUILD depends:
    • chicken5>0:lang/chicken5
  • For LIB depends:
    • libchicken5.so:lang/chicken5
To install the port: cd /usr/ports/lang/chicken5/ && make install clean
To add the package, run one of these commands:
  • pkg install lang/chicken5
  • pkg install chicken5
PKGNAME: chicken5
Flavors: there is no flavor information for this port.
distinfo:
Packages (timestamps in pop-ups are UTC):
chicken5
ABIlatestquarterly
FreeBSD:11:aarch645.0.0.r25.2.0
FreeBSD:11:amd645.2.05.2.0
FreeBSD:11:armv6-5.2.0
FreeBSD:11:i3865.2.05.2.0
FreeBSD:11:mips--
FreeBSD:11:mips64-5.2.0
FreeBSD:12:aarch645.0.0.r25.2.0
FreeBSD:12:amd645.2.05.2.0
FreeBSD:12:armv65.0.0.r25.2.0
FreeBSD:12:armv75.0.0.r35.2.0
FreeBSD:12:i3865.2.05.2.0
FreeBSD:12:mips--
FreeBSD:12:mips645.0.0.r35.2.0
FreeBSD:12:powerpc64-5.2.0
FreeBSD:13:aarch645.2.05.2.0
FreeBSD:13:amd645.2.05.2.0
FreeBSD:13:armv65.2.05.2.0
FreeBSD:13:armv75.2.05.2.0
FreeBSD:13:i3865.2.05.2.0
FreeBSD:13:mips--
FreeBSD:13:mips645.2.05.2.0
FreeBSD:13:powerpc645.2.05.2.0
FreeBSD:14:aarch645.2.0-
FreeBSD:14:amd645.2.0-
FreeBSD:14:armv65.2.0-
FreeBSD:14:armv75.2.0-
FreeBSD:14:i3865.2.0-
FreeBSD:14:mips--
FreeBSD:14:mips645.2.0-
FreeBSD:14:powerpc645.2.0-
 

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. gmake>=4.3 : devel/gmake
There are no ports dependent upon this port

Configuration Options:
Options name:

USES:

pkg-message:
If installing:
Master Sites:
Expand this list (1 items)
Collapse this list.
  1. https://code.call-cc.org/releases/5.2.0/
Collapse this list.
Port Moves
  • port moved here from lang/chicken on 2019-12-22
    REASON: Has expired: Old release; please migrate to lang/chicken5

Number of commits found: 14

Commit History - (may be incomplete: see SVNWeb link above for full details)
DateByDescription
23 Aug 2021 08:17:12
 files touched by this commit commit hash:80236c9d744badff69982f2b049765e49be3e7ca  5.2.0
gahr search for other commits by this committer
lang/chicken5: take maintainership
06 Apr 2021 14:31:07
 files touched by this commit commit hash:305f148f482daf30dcf728039d03d019f88344eb  5.2.0
mat search for other commits by this committer
Remove # $FreeBSD$ from Makefiles.
28 Sep 2020 05:05:25
Original commit files touched by this commit Revision:550400  5.2.0
tobik search for other commits by this committer
Reset MAINTAINER
01 Mar 2020 11:09:59
Original commit files touched by this commit Revision:527546  5.2.0
tobik search for other commits by this committer
lang/chicken5: Update to 5.2.0

Changes:	https://code.call-cc.org/releases/5.2.0/NEWS
18 Jun 2019 22:03:18
Original commit files touched by this commit Revision:504506  5.1.0
tobik search for other commits by this committer
lang/chicken5: Also commit pkg-message changes after r504505
18 Jun 2019 22:02:27
Original commit files touched by this commit Revision:504505  5.1.0
tobik search for other commits by this committer
lang/chicken5: Update to 5.1.0

While here

- Add LICENSE
- Only show pkg-message on install

Changes:	https://code.call-cc.org/releases/5.1.0/NEWS
18 Jun 2019 21:50:38
Original commit files touched by this commit Revision:504504  5.0.0
tobik search for other commits by this committer
lang/chicken5: Cosmetic changes

- Pet portfmt and portclippy
07 Nov 2018 20:57:52
Original commit files touched by this commit Revision:484409  5.0.0
tobik search for other commits by this committer
lang/chicken5: Update to 5.0.0

Announcement:	http://lists.nongnu.org/archive/html/chicken-users/2018-11/msg00006.html
29 Oct 2018 18:45:50
Original commit files touched by this commit Revision:483398  5.0.0.r4
tobik search for other commits by this committer
lang/chicken5: Update to 5.0.0rc4

Announcement:	http://lists.nongnu.org/archive/html/chicken-users/2018-10/msg00030.html
09 Oct 2018 05:49:05
Original commit files touched by this commit Revision:481600  5.0.0.r3
tobik search for other commits by this committer
lang/chicken5: Update to 5.0.0rc3

- While here drop some unnecessary patches

Changes:	http://code.call-cc.org/dev-snapshots/2018/10/08/NEWS
09 Sep 2018 13:23:45
Original commit files touched by this commit Revision:479289  5.0.0.r2
tobik search for other commits by this committer
lang/chicken5: Update to 5.0.0rc2

Changes:	http://code.call-cc.org/dev-snapshots/2018/09/09/NEWS
07 Sep 2018 10:52:52
Original commit files touched by this commit Revision:479186  5.0.0.r1_1
tobik search for other commits by this committer
lang/chicken5: Mark as MAKE_JOBS_UNSAFE again

I was too optimistic about the fix from r478932 and it quickly falls
to pieces with a higher number (> 16) of jobs.  Upstream has never
supported building in parallel either.
04 Sep 2018 07:37:57
Original commit files touched by this commit Revision:478932  5.0.0.r1_1
tobik search for other commits by this committer
lang/chicken5: Obtain entropy via arc4random_buf on FreeBSD too

Also fix parallel build while here
22 Aug 2018 17:46:21
Original commit files touched by this commit Revision:477802  5.0.0.r1
tobik search for other commits by this committer
New port: lang/chicken5

CHICKEN is a compiler for the Scheme programming language. CHICKEN
produces portable, efficient C, supports almost all of the R5RS
Scheme language standard, and includes many enhancements and
extensions.

WWW: http://www.call-cc.org/

CHICKEN 4 and 5 are not fully compatible.  Import the upcoming
CHICKEN 5.0.0 as a new port.  Binaries and libraries are suffixed
with a 5 to avoid conflicts with lang/chicken.

Changes:	https://code.call-cc.org/dev-snapshots/2018/08/11/NEWS
PR:		230535

Number of commits found: 14